135. This World Is Not My Home

1 I’ve left the way of death and sin,
The road that many travel in;
And if you ask the reason why,
I seek a glorious home on high.

Chorus:
This world, this world is not my home,
This world, this world is not my home,
This world is not my resting place,
This world, this world is not my home.

2 Tho’ many would my progress stay,
And beg me not to watch and pray;
I dare not listen to their cry;
I seek a glorious home on high. [Chorus]

3 O sinner, come and go with me,
And seek this land of liberty;
O, do not stay, but tell me why
You do not seek this home on high. [Chorus]
